What a Mesothelioma Diagnosis Means

September 27th, 2009 Garret No comments

Being diagnosed with mesothelioma often takes place after years of exposure to asbestos, and the symptoms often do not show up until 20 to 50 years later. A mesothelioma diagnosis does not have to mean a death sentence, but since mesothelioma is a form of cancer, contracting the disease is certainly serious. In the past, the dangers of asbestos were not actually well known, so many people worked with the material without proper respiratory protection. In addition, mesothelioma affected their loved ones, who were also exposed to the asbestos through washing their clothes and coming into physical contact with them.


Naturally, a mesothelioma diagnosis can be very frightening and upsetting for the person and his or her family. In addition, mesothelioma symptoms can reach a point where they are extremely debilitating, and they can be fatal. Mesothelioma Settlements Allow Victims to Cope

September 24th, 2009 Garret No comments

The diagnosis of mesothelioma is one that is difficult to grasp and accept. Mesothelioma is a rare form of cancer that attacks the mesothelium surrounding certain organs, particularly the lungs. Mesothelioma is most often seen in people with prolonged asbestos exposure.


If mesothelioma is diagnosed, it is possible to receive standard cancer treatments such as radiation, chemotherapy, and surgery. A good way for mesothelioma victims to cope with this devastating cancer is to file for a mesothelioma settlement.
